Aush (Afghani Chili)

INGREDIENTS

  • Meat

    • 🍖 1 pound ground beef
  • Vegetables

    • 🧅 1 onion, coarsely chopped
    • 🍅 1 (28 ounce) can diced tomatoes, with juice
    • 1 (15 ounce) can garbanzo beans (chickpeas), drained
    • 1 (10 ounce) box frozen chopped spinach, thawed and drained
  • Spices

    • 🧄 1 tablespoon minced garlic
    • 1 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
    • 1 ½ tablespoons ground cumin
    • 2 teaspoons chili powder
    • 1 ½ tablespoons dried mint
    • 2 tablespoons garam masala
  • Dairy

    • 1 cup sour cream
  • Pasta

    • 🍝 1 (16 ounce) package fettuccine, broken in half

STEPS

1

Brown ground beef in a skillet over medium heat; remove beef with a slotted spoon to a large pot, reserving drippings in the skillet. Cook and stir onion in reserved drippings until golden brown; remove with a slotted spoon and add to beef in the pot. Stir tomatoes with juice, garlic, red pepper, cumin, chili powder, mint, garam masala, garbanzo beans, and spinach into beef mixture; simmer over low heat for 3 to 6 hours.

2

Fill a large pot with lightly salted water and bring to a rolling boil over high heat; stir in fettuccini and return to a boil. Cook pasta uncovered, stirring occasionally, until cooked through but still firm to the bite, about 8 minutes. Drain well; stir pasta into the chili along with sour cream. Serve hot.

💡 Feel free to substitute ground lamb or turkey for the ground beef based on your dietary preference.Make the dish in a slow cooker for added convenience.Serve the dish with flatbread or naan for an authentic experience.
